NBXDBB017LNHTAG Description
The NBXDBB017LNHTAG is a dual-frequency oscillator and crystal from onsemi, designed to provide precise timing solutions for a variety of electronic applications. This component is part of the PureEdge™ series, known for its high performance and reliability. The NBXDBB017LNHTAG operates at two distinct frequencies, 156.25MHz and 312.5MHz, making it versatile for applications requiring multiple timing options. It features a surface mount package, specifically a 6-CLCC, which is ideal for compact designs and high-density PCB layouts. The oscillator is powered by a supply voltage ranging from 2.97V to 3.63V and draws a current of 78 mA, ensuring efficient power usage. The component is packaged in tape and reel (TR) format, facilitating automated assembly processes. Despite being classified as obsolete, the NBXDBB017LNHTAG remains a valuable option for legacy systems and specific applications where its unique specifications are required. It is REACH unaffected, ensuring compliance with environmental regulations.
